Understanding the Emotional Signals That Say “I’m Ready”

Before you log in to any dating platform, pause and listen to your inner voice. Hungarian women often juggle family expectations, career ambitions, and cultural traditions. Recognizing genuine readiness helps you avoid repeating old patterns.

Key emotional signs

Signal What it Means How to Act
Calm excitement about meeting new people Your heart is open, not anxious Set small, low‑pressure goals (e.g., a short chat)
Ability to talk about past relationships without bitterness Healing has begun Share lessons learned only when you feel comfortable
Confidence in your daily routine You’ve re‑established personal stability Use this confidence to present yourself authentically online

When these cues appear, you’re likely at a healthy crossroads. If doubts linger, consider a short “dating pause” to focus on hobbies, friends, or a short‑term personal project. Remember, there is no universal timetable—your pace matters most.

Communication Strategies That Turn Matches into Meaningful Dates

Matching is only the first step. How you converse determines whether you move from chat to coffee.

1. Start with Specific Questions

Instead of a generic “How are you?” ask, “What’s your favorite place to enjoy a sunset in Hungary?” This invites storytelling and reveals personality.

2. Mirror Their Energy

If your match replies with short answers, respond in a similar style. If they are expressive, match that enthusiasm. This creates a natural rhythm.

3. Set Clear Intentions Early

After a few pleasant exchanges, suggest a low‑key meet‑up. For example:

“I really enjoy talking about Hungarian folk music. Would you like to join me for a live concert at the Palace of Arts next Friday?”
